Luxemburger Wort
Luxemburger Wort is one of Luxembourg's largest and most established daily newspapers, published mainly in German alongside French and other content. A general-interest title with a long history in the Grand Duchy, it covers national politics, society and the economy. It has traditionally been associated with a Christian-democratic, centre-right editorial outlook.
